15/// HiGHS solver handle.
16///
17/// [`Solver::solve`] builds a fresh HiGHS instance for each call, so models can be
18/// re-used or shared freely. For repeated solves of one model (parameter sweeps,
19/// sensitivity studies, rolling horizons), build a resident handle with
20/// [`Highs::persistent`](PersistentSolver::persistent).
21#[derive(Debug, Default, Clone, Copy)]
22pub struct Highs;
23
24/// Display name for this backend; the single source for both [`Solver::name`]
25/// and the `solver_name` stamped on every [`SolverResult`].
26pub(crate) const NAME: &str = "HiGHS";
27
28/// The model kinds HiGHS can solve: linear models and quadratic-objective QP.
29pub(crate) const fn supported(kind: ModelKind) -> bool {
30    matches!(kind, ModelKind::LP | ModelKind::MILP | ModelKind::QP)
31}
